Materials and Manufacturing Impact
The production of the Ifi Zen Air Dac 2026 involves various materials, including metals, plastics, and electronic components. The extraction and processing of these materials have environmental consequences, such as habitat disruption, energy consumption, and pollution. Manufacturing processes also contribute to carbon emissions, especially if they rely on fossil fuels.
Material Sourcing
Many electronic components require rare earth elements and metals like gold, copper, and aluminum. The mining of these materials often leads to environmental degradation and social issues in mining regions. Ethical sourcing and recycling initiatives can mitigate some of these impacts.
Manufacturing Processes
Manufacturing facilities consume significant energy, often derived from non-renewable sources. The carbon footprint associated with production can be reduced through cleaner energy sources, improved efficiency, and sustainable practices.
Energy Consumption During Use
The Ifi Zen Air Dac 2026 is designed to be energy-efficient compared to older models. However, its operation still requires electricity, which may come from fossil fuels depending on the energy grid. Using renewable energy sources for powering devices can significantly reduce environmental impact.
Power Efficiency
Modern digital devices are increasingly optimized for low power consumption. The Zen Air Dac 2026 incorporates energy-saving features, but continuous use still contributes to overall electricity demand.
Impact of Energy Source
The environmental footprint of using the device depends heavily on how the electricity is generated. Renewable sources like wind and solar have a much lower impact compared to coal or natural gas.
End-of-Life and Recycling
Electronic waste is a major environmental concern. Proper disposal and recycling of devices like the Ifi Zen Air Dac 2026 are crucial to minimizing environmental harm. Recycling helps recover valuable materials and reduces the need for new resource extraction.
Recycling Challenges
Electronic devices contain complex assemblies that can be difficult to disassemble. Improper disposal can lead to toxic substances leaching into the environment. Manufacturers and consumers play a role in promoting responsible recycling practices.
Sustainable Design and Lifecycle
Designing for durability, repairability, and upgradability extends the lifespan of electronic devices. The longer a device remains functional, the lower its environmental impact over time.
